Enthalpy of vaporization

ΔvapH (kJ/mol) Temperature (K) Method Reference Comment
74.4390.AStephenson and Malanowski, 1987Based on data from 375. - 519. K. See also Stull, 1947.; AC

Antoine Equation Parameters

log10(P) = A − (B / (T + C))
    P = vapor pressure (bar)
    T = temperature (K)

Temperature (K) A B C Reference Comment
375. - 519.06.632193152.908-43.564Stull, 1947Coefficents calculated by NIST from author's data.

Enthalpy of fusion

ΔfusH (kJ/mol) Temperature (K) Reference Comment
9.22306.2Acree, 1991AC
